Associate Director, Client Activation- People Inc Health Group
The Health Group is looking for an experienced, client-facing project management lead to support advertiser-sponsored native and editorial programs for our pharmaceutical partners. You will be part of a three-person team supporting the largest advertiser revenue category at People Inc.  You’ll manage several projects simultaneously while balancing timelines, deliverables, and client expectations, and you’ll confidently navigate obstacles and next steps with minimal oversight.
Assignment Details: 
35 hours a week
Start date: 4/6/2024
End date: Up to 5 months (exact end date TBD)
Hourly Rate: $55-70 
Location: Hybrid- New York (3 days/week in office)
Assignment Responsibilities:
  • Oversee project management for multifaceted custom content programs that could include print, digital, video, social and editorial elements
  • Guide programs from pre-sale consultation through post-sale activation, partnering closely with Sales, Content Strategy, and Account Strategy to ensure smooth handoffs and strong execution
  • Develop and maintain project deliverables, including scope of work, timelines, and creative guidelines
  • Ensure all projects are delivered on time and align with client expectations.
  • Lead internal and external client meetings and written communication, manage ongoing weekly status calls, and provide consistent, high-quality service and communication to both our internal partners and all People Inc. client partners.
  • Maintain comprehensive meeting notes and project status documents to ensure alignment across teams, with the ultimate goal of ensuring client satisfaction.
  • Contribute to end-of-campaign debriefs by sharing insights, learnings, and recommendations to continuously enhance future program delivery and team processes.
Skills/Experience:
  • Bachelor’s degree is preferred, but relevant work experience and qualifications will be equally weighted
  • Minimum 6-8 years of activation, project management or production experience, working on multifaceted campaigns with successful history of project completion
  • Previous experience in healthcare and pharmaceutical media, with familiarity of content regulatory review processes, is strongly preferred
  • Superb written and business communication skills
  • Team player with strong interpersonal skills, collaborative instincts, and confidence engaging with client and agency stakeholders
  • Eye for detail, with a passion for project management and task completion
